Lapis
Lapis is made to suit advertisers that require creating a number of ad variations within a short period. It is not a platform where most creatives are made through AI but rather a platform that creates performance-based ad creatives through AI.
Marketers are able to post their brand resources like logos, product images, colors, and messages guidelines. The platform will then create varied ad creatives to various platforms automatically. It assists companies in accelerating their idea to campaign.
Advertisers are able to produce plenty of variations to be tested and optimized (instead of creating a single ad at a time).

Creatopy
Creatopy aims at automation and consistency of brands in advertising campaigns. Through the platform, teams can create, administer, and scale big amounts of advertisements and maintain visual branding.
Automated resizing and format adjustments are one of its largest strengths. Various social media outlets have different sizes of ads, and this may be manual in nature and may get tedious.
This is simplified through creatopy. Advertisers do not have to redesign their creatives to fit different placements. This saves time and effort to expanding brands with several campaigns going on.
Pencil
Pencil has a slightly varied strategy of integrating AI creativity and performance analysis. It examines the past campaign successes and utilizes those findings to create new advertisement content that will be effective.
This is what makes Pencil particularly appealing to the marketers who are preoccupied with the process of continuous improvement. The platform proposes the creative variations instead of guessing on which design would be most effective, basing on the actual campaign experience.
Vista Create
VistaCreate, which was previously called Crello, is a design platform that resembles Canva, with additional AI-based capabilities. It offers many templates and visual aids to enable marketers to make interesting ad creatives in an hour.
Even though it continues to emphasize a lot on the flexibility of its designs, the platform has progressively added automation features that contribute to facilitating the process of ad production. VistaCreate can be a smooth transition to marketers wishing to have the familiar but a little more advanced than Canva.
It is especially effective in the field of social media campaigns where graphics are required to be very appealing and the turnaround has to be fast.
